So, first we need to draw a simple geometric figure in the form of an oval, reminiscent of an ordinary chicken egg. Perhaps the baby will not get it quite right the first time, so the presence of parents during the creative process is not only extremely desirable, but also mandatory. To the already obtained oval, we need to draw small ears, as in the picture. In shape, they resemble something similar to a slightly elongated semicircle. It is very easy to draw such figures and the child will quickly cope with them.
Now let's add some details thatare required for our future frog - these are eyes in the form of large fat dots, a wide smile and front legs. Thus, our drawing acquired a resemblance to a real grasshopper. We only have to draw the characteristic hind legs and tongue of this amphibian, as can be seen in the picture. After all the details have been drawn, it is necessary to erase all unnecessary lines with an eraser. If desired, the child can color the frog and it will become even more beautiful.
